Hawker Hunter (HB-RVW)
AIR-14, Payerne/CH
Hawker Hunter TMk.68 (ex. J-4203) now HB-RVW together with
DH-115 Vampire Mk55 (ex. U-1208) now HB-RVF and Tiger F5-F J-3201.
